Creamy Pistachio Pomegranate Galette

A Savory‑Sweet Galette That Steals the Wine Night Spotlight Present this appetizer as the seat at the best‑lit corner of the table to immediately become the most interesting and appetizing item in the room. This galette is my love letter to Persian flavors and the kind of textural drama that keeps you going back for “just one more bite.” It starts with a rustic, golden pie crust—simple, flaky, and intentionally imperfect in that charming, French‑bakery way. But the real magic is what’s tucked inside: a velvety blend of sweet Italian pistachio butter and tangy mascarpone, baked together until the edges caramelize and the center turns irresistibly creamy. Once it cools, the whole thing gets dressed up for the occasion. A generous handful of chopped roasted and salted pistachios adds crunch and a hit of savory depth, while ruby‑red pomegranate seeds bring brightness, juiciness, and that unmistakable Persian sparkle.
